STEP 1.Cook beans in a pressure cooker with bay leaves and water. cook it at high flame and when it reaches high pressure reduce the flame to medium and cook it for 20 minutes. Drain the water when your beans are cooked.
STEP 2.Stock the collard green leaves on top of each other and roll them to form a cylinder. Slice these rolls into thin strips .Heat some oil in a pan and saute 2 garlic cloves in it for about 2 minutes.
STEP 3.To this add the collard green leaves and cook it for 5 minutes. Season it with some salt and black pepper . Add bacon to the same pan and cook until it turns golden brown .
STEP 4.Stir fry the onions and remaining garlic for 2 minutes. Add sausages and drained beans to it and cook it for a minute . Now add collard green and eggs in it . Season with some salt and gradually add roasted flour in it and combine well.
STEP 5.Turn off the flame and garnish with chopped parsley and spring onions .
